### sec.683 Effect of commencement on particular applications
This section applies to the following applications made, but not decided, before the commencement—
an application for an environmental authority (mining activities) made under former chapter 5; and
an application to amend, surrender or transfer an environmental authority (mining activities).
From the commencement—
processing of the application and all matters incidental to the processing must proceed as if the amending Act had not been enacted; and
an environmental authority granted, amended or transferred is taken to be an environmental authority to which section 682 applies.
See, however, section 749.
s 683 ins 2012 No. 16 s 60
amd 2016 No. 61 s 9
